Acknowledgment Statements
Organisation Name Organisation Type Grant ID (if applies) Relationship Type Suggested Acknowledgment
WeNMR EC Project 261572 using EGI The WeNMR project (European FP7 e-Infrastructure grant, contract no. 261572, www.wenmr.eu), supported by the European Grid Initiative (EGI) through the national GRID Initiatives of Belgium, France, Italy, Germany, the Netherlands (via the Dutch BiG Grid project), Portugal, Spain, UK, South Africa, Taiwan and the Latin America GRID infrastructure via the Gisela project is acknowledged for the use of web portals, computing and storage facilities.
EGI-InSPIRE EC Project 261323 supporting EGI The authors acknowledge the use of resources provided by the European Grid Infrastructure. For more information, please reference the EGI-InSPIRE paper (http://go.egi.eu/pdnon).
ATLAS Virtual Organisation n/a using EGI The crucial computing support from all WLCG partners is acknowledged gratefully, in particular from CERN and the ATLAS Tier-1 facilities at TRIUMF (Canada), NDGF (Denmark, Norway, Sweden), CCIN2P3 (France), KIT/GridKA (Germany), INFN-CNAF (Italy), NL-T1 (Netherlands), PIC (Spain), ASGC (Taiwan), RAL (UK) and BNL (USA) and in the Tier-2 facilities worldwide
CMS Virtual Organisation n/a using EGI We thank the computing centres in the Worldwide LHC computing Grid for the provisioning and excellent performance of computing infrastructure essential to our analyses.
LHCb Virtual Organisation n/a using EGI The Tier1 computing centres are supported by IN2P3 (France), KIT and BMBF (Germany), INFN (Italy), NWO and SURF (The Netherlands), PIC (Spain), GridPP (United Kingdom). We are thankful for the computing resources put at our disposal by Yandex LLC (Russia), as well as to the communities behind the multiple open source software packages that we depend on.
EMI EC Project 261611 supporting EGI
NA62 Virtual Organisation n/a using EGI We acknowledge the use of Grid computing resources deployed and operated by (GridPP in the UK) or (the worldwide LHC computing Grid).
